Interim Prime Minister Commodore Frank Bainimarama said it is evident from the places where he had visited that the people of the country want a positive change in Fiji.

Commodore Bainimarama said there are positive reactions in relation to the draft People's Charter based on that because people living in the rural areas have been given false promises for years by politicians and previous governments.

He said he had been telling the people that their lives will truly change if they accept the draft Charter.
